Meir Pichhadze (1955-2010), Surreal Allegory
Oil on canvas
1976
Signed "Meir Pich" and dated 1976 (lower middle).
61 x 50 cm
Provenance: Yaakov Applewig Gallery (closed during the 1980's).
Private collection.
Notes: Gideon Ofrat on Pichhadze's paintings during this period (second half of the 1970s): "[his paintings] had ta surrealist appearance, as if from the kitchen of Salvador Dali, with slender women among twisted Art Nouveau motifs and set against a backdrop of infinite landscapes tinged with fantastic realism. They were strongly influenced by the tall, thin, blue figures painted by his sister - Makvala - at the time.
